04.01.2015 Views

CR1000 Manual - Campbell Scientific

CR1000 Manual - Campbell Scientific

CR1000 Manual - Campbell Scientific

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Section 8. Operation<br />

8.5.7 PakBus Encryption<br />

As shown in figure LoggerNet Device-Map Setup: Dataloggers (p. 362), set the<br />

PakBus® address for each <strong>CR1000</strong> as listed in table PakBus-LAN Example<br />

Datalogger-Communications Settings (p. 360).<br />

PakBus encryption allows two end devices to exchange encrypted commands and<br />

data. Routers and other leaf nodes do not need to be set for encryption. The<br />

<strong>CR1000</strong> has a setting accessed through DevConfig that sets it to send / receive<br />

only encrypted commands and data. LoggerNet, likewise, has a setting attached<br />

to the specific station that enables it to send and receive only encrypted<br />

commands and data. Header level information needed for routing is not<br />

encrypted. Encryption uses the AES-128 algorithm.<br />

<strong>Campbell</strong> <strong>Scientific</strong> products supporting PakBus encryption include the<br />

following:<br />

• LoggerNet 4.2<br />

• <strong>CR1000</strong> datalogger (OS26 and newer)<br />

• CR3000 datalogger (OS26 and newer)<br />

• CR800 series dataloggers (OS26 and newer)<br />

• Device Configuration Utility (DevConfig) v. 2.04 and newer<br />

• Network Planner v. 1.6 and newer.<br />

Portions of the protocol to which PakBus encryption is applied include:<br />

• All BMP5 messages<br />

• All settings related messages<br />

Note Basic PakCtrl messages such as Hello, Hello Request, Send Neighbors,<br />

Get Neighbors, and Echo are NOT encrypted.<br />

The PakBus encryption key can be set in the <strong>CR1000</strong> datalogger through:<br />

• DevConfig Deployment tab<br />

• DevConfig Settings Editor tab<br />

• PakBusGraph settings editor dialogue<br />

• <strong>CR1000</strong>KD keyboard display. The keyboard is the only way to clear the key<br />

if the key is forgotten. The datalogger should be kept in a secure location to<br />

prevent keypad access.<br />

Note Encryption key cannot be set through the CRBasic datalogger program.<br />

Setting the encryption key in datalogger support software (LoggerNet 4.2 and<br />

higher):<br />

• Applies to <strong>CR1000</strong>, CR3000, CR800 series dataloggers, and PakBus routers,<br />

and PakBus port device types.<br />

• Can be set through the LoggerNet Set Up screen, Network Planner, or<br />

CoraScript (only CoraScript can set the setting for a PakBus port).<br />

363

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!